计算机操作系统是计算机系统中最重要的一部分,它负责管理计算机的资源并为用户提供一个良好的工作环境。操作系统是控制和管理计算机硬件和软件资源、合理地组织计算机工作流程以及方便用户有效地使用计算机的程序集合。在计算机科学领域,操作系统是一个非常重要的研究方向,它不仅影响着计算机的性能和稳定性,还直接影响着用户的体验。
操作系统负责管理计算机的硬件资源,如CPU、内存、硬盘、网络等,它通过任务调度、内存管理、文件管理、网络通信等功能,将这些硬件资源有效地分配给各个应用程序,从而保证系统的稳定运行。同时,操作系统还提供了一些用户接口,如命令行界面、图形界面等,让用户能够方便地与计算机进行交互,执行各种操作。
不同的操作系统有着不同的设计思想和特点,如硬件相关、应用无关,核心常驻内存,中断驱动,权威性,庞大、复杂,重要性(无处不在、无时不有)并发、共享、虚拟、异步等。它们还都遵循着相似的基本原则,如并发控制、内存管理、文件系统等。
操作系统功能有(引入操作系统的主要目的是最大限度地发挥计算机系统资源的使用效率和方便用户使用):1、资源管理工作:处理机管理—进程管理—充分利用,存储管理—方便多进程共享,设备管理—与处理机并行,文件管理—组织、存储、保护。2、方便用户使用: 作业管理—为用户提供一个使用系统的良好环境。3、操作系统的工作:启动和结束程序、用户程序对OS的调用、为常用操作提供程序、解决效率和安全问题。
随着计算机技术的不断进步,操作系统也在不断地发展和演变。现代操作系统不仅具有更高的性能和稳定性,还加入了许多新的功能和特性,如虚拟化技术、容器技术等,为用户提供了更便利和安全的计算环境。 总之,计算机操作系统是计算机系统中不可或缺的一部分,它管理着计算机的资源,并为用户提供了一个良好的工作环境。
标签:计算机,管理,用户,内存,方便,操作系统 From: https://www.cnblogs.com/zwj120992/p/18170301